1

Java Back End Developer Jobs in Maryland (NOW HIRING)

Senior Backend Programmer

Rockville, MD · On-site

$122K - $159K/yr

Solid Golang or Java * Proficiency with Python or C# Microservice architectures * Proficiency in ... developer perspective * Knowledge of database schema and scaling methodologies to further ...

Java Developer

Rockville, MD

$52 - $67.25/hr

I'm looking for a full-stack developer who can do both front-end and back-end work. Main technologies I'm looking for are Java, AngularJS, and relational database programming skills Qualifications I ...

Adobe AEM Developer Job Location: Bethesda, MD Job Type: Contract * AEM Development: Design ... Java Backend Focus: Implement robust server-side logic using Java, Apache Sling Models, OSGi ...

You will act as a senior backend developer for a new system being developed from the ground up to ... Experience with Java microservice development using Spring Boot. * Familiarity with SQL and NoSQL ...

Overview Backend Software Engineer Gaithersburg, MD Active TS (SCI eligibility) clearance and ... Design, develop, test, and maintain backend services using Java or Python * REST API Development:

Backend Java Developer

Hagerstown, MD · On-site

$104K - $173K/yr

Proficiency in Java programming language * Proficiency in Spring Boot or Quarkus web frameworks * Knowledge of Contexts and Dependency Injection (CDI) in Java * Experience w/ one or more major cloud ...

Backend Software Engineer Gaithersburg, MD Active TS (SCI eligibility) clearance and eligibility to ... Design, develop, test, and maintain backend services using Java or Python * REST API Development:

Backend Java Developer

Hagerstown, MD · On-site

$104K - $173K/yr

Proficiency in Java programming language * Proficiency in Spring Boot or Quarkus web frameworks * Knowledge of Contexts and Dependency Injection (CDI) in Java * Experience w/ one or more major cloud ...

Overview Backend Software Engineer Gaithersburg, MD Active TS (SCI eligibility) clearance and ... Design, develop, test, and maintain backend services using Java or Python * REST API Development:

Back-End Java Developer

Annapolis Junction, MD · On-site

$52 - $67.50/hr

CTC Group is seeking a Java Developer to join a group of high-performing developers and engineers in shaping the modernization of geolocation products supporting the warfighter. The role involves ...

next page

Showing results 1-20

Java Back End Developer information

See Maryland salary details

$9

$53

$71

How much do java back end developer jobs pay per hour?

As of Jun 18, 2026, the average hourly pay for java back end developer in Maryland is $53.02, according to ZipRecruiter salary data. Most workers in this role earn between $47.12 and $61.11 per hour, depending on experience, location, and employer.

What does a typical day look like for a Java Back End Developer?

A typical day for a Java Back End Developer often involves writing and reviewing code, designing and implementing APIs, and collaborating with front-end developers, QA testers, and other team members to ensure seamless integration and functionality. Developers participate in daily stand-up meetings, work with version control systems, troubleshoot technical issues, and continually optimize application performance. You may also engage in code reviews, work on database design, or implement new features based on customer or business needs. This dynamic environment emphasizes both independent problem-solving and teamwork, offering continuous learning opportunities and a fast-paced, innovative workflow.

What is a Java Back End Developer job?

A Java Back End Developer is responsible for building and maintaining the server-side logic of web applications using Java. They work with databases, APIs, and server architecture to ensure smooth data processing and application functionality. Their tasks include writing efficient code, optimizing performance, and integrating front-end components. They often use frameworks like Spring Boot and Hibernate to develop scalable and secure applications.

What are the key skills and qualifications needed to thrive in the Java Back End Developer position, and why are they important?

To thrive as a Java Back End Developer, you need solid proficiency in Java programming, knowledge of frameworks like Spring or Hibernate, and experience with database management, often supported by a degree in computer science or related fields. Familiarity with tools such as Git, RESTful APIs, build automation systems (e.g., Maven/Gradle), and sometimes certifications like Oracle Certified Professional, Java SE, are highly valued. Strong problem-solving skills, attention to detail, effective communication, and a collaborative mindset help professionals excel in this role. These combined technical and soft skills are crucial for developing robust, scalable back-end systems and ensuring smooth teamwork in dynamic software development environments.

What are popular job titles related to Java Back End Developer jobs in Maryland? For Java Back End Developer jobs in Maryland, the most frequently searched job titles are:
What job categories do people searching Java Back End Developer jobs in Maryland look for? The top searched job categories for Java Back End Developer jobs in Maryland are:
What are popular job titles related to Java Back End Developer jobs in MD? For Java Back End Developer jobs in MD, the most frequently searched job titles are:
Infographic showing various Java Back End Developer job openings in Maryland as of June 2026, with employment types broken down into 73% Full Time, and 27% Contract. Highlights an 74% In-person, and 26% Remote job distribution, with an average salary of $110,284 per year, or $53 per hour.
Back End Developer - Mid with Security Clearance

Back End Developer - Mid with Security Clearance

Mount Indie, LLC

Fort George G Meade, MD • Hybrid

Other

Posted 9 days ago


Job description

Join a team working in Cloud-based architecture leveraging enterprise-level services. The technical environment inlcudes DEVSECOPS platform supporting SAFe/Agile development. You'll join a team accelerating mission planning and execution across all cyber echelonsThis role is onsite five days a week at Fort Meade, MD, and requires an active TS/SCI security clearance.

Job-Specific Essential Duties and Responsibilities: Provides subject matter proficiency supporting back-end software development activities. Applies analytical skills supporting process improvement, specialized studies, and requirements definition. * Performs analysis, planning, and development of requirements documents and functional models.

Designs and develops back-end architectures supporting system capabilities and integrations. Develops and modifies RESTful APIs supporting application functionality. * Performs database management, data modeling, and optimization.

Supports testing and validation to verify system operability and compliance. Participates in Agile program increment (PI) planning and activities requiring periodic travels. Job-Specific Minimum Requirements: * Active TS/SCI clearance is required.

Must be able to report on-site in San Antonio, TX up to five days per week based on customer requirements. Bachelor's degree in related field required. * A Master's degree may substitute for 2 years of experience.

7 years of software development experience in object-oriented and scripted languages with the ability to apply several tool suites related to DevSecOps, microservices and containers. 3 years of experience with bug tracking software (Jira). * 3 years of experience testing web-based applications.

3 years of experience participating in software development programs or projects. 3 years of experience performing back-end web design and development. * 3 years of experience with the following: AWS Infrastructure, Kubernetes, and RedHat Linux.

5 years of experience with Jenkins and GitLab. 5 years of experience with at least five (5) of the following: Postgress RDS Exodus Python Luna Java Docker OpenJDK Ansible Packer Maven Kubernetes Red Hat Demonstrated experience with relational databases, RESTful API development and communication, and system integrations. * Demonstrated experience in preparing, conducting, and documenting various systems tests and results to verify system operability and compliance with project standards and requirements.

Practical experience developing in a cloud environment. Experience with integrating data from unclassified to classified application deployments. Preferred Skills and Qualifications: * Experience using Agile Test-Driven development.

Experience integrating into DoW DevSecOps environments. 5 years of experience with CI/CD software development. * Demonstrated experience in utilizing UX design tool suites (e.g., Sketch, InVision).

  • Experience structuring data so it can be integrated into machine learning technologies or AI capabilities.